Component: IS-M-SD
Component Name: Media Sales and Distribution
Description: Smallest geographical unit in which home delivery of titles is possible. A carrier route is a special type of route. It is used to create a geographical structure for home delivery of editions. No other kinds of distribution, in particular insertion usually of ad pre-prints, are possible for an individual carrier route.
